Explication de la TCAM

Introduction à la mémoire TCAM

La mémoire ternaire adressable par le contenu (TCAM) est un type spécialisé de mémoire informatique utilisé pour stocker des données d’une manière qui permet d’effectuer des opérations de comparaison rapides sur les données stockées. Elle est couramment utilisée dans les applications réseau telles que les routeurs, les commutateurs et les pare-feu.

Structure de la TCAM

La TCAM est composée de plusieurs colonnes et rangées de cellules de mémoire, chaque cellule ayant trois états différents : 0, 1, ou « don’t care ». Chaque rangée de cellules de mémoire est appelée un « mot » et chaque colonne de cellules est appelée un « bit ».

fonctionnement de la TCAM

Lorsqu’une donnée est stockée dans la TCAM, elle est comparée à une clé de recherche, qui est également stockée dans la mémoire. Si les données correspondent à la clé, la cellule de mémoire est mise à 1. Si les données ne correspondent pas à la clé, la cellule de mémoire est mise à

Si les données ne sont pas pertinentes pour la recherche, la cellule de mémoire est mise à « don’t care ».
avantages de la TCAM

La TCAM permet des opérations de recherche et de comparaison rapides, ainsi qu’une densité de mémoire élevée. Elle est également capable d’effectuer des recherches complexes, comme la comparaison de motifs, ce qui la rend idéale pour les applications réseau.

Inconvénients de la TCAM

La TCAM est plus chère que les autres types de mémoire, et elle consomme plus d’énergie. De plus, la TCAM ne convient pas aux applications qui nécessitent des mises à jour fréquentes des données, car les cellules de mémoire doivent être complètement vidées avant que de nouvelles données puissent être stockées.

Applications de la TCAM

La TCAM est couramment utilisée dans les applications réseau telles que les routeurs, les commutateurs et les pare-feu. Elle est également utilisée dans les applications de sécurité des réseaux, comme les systèmes de détection d’intrusion, et dans les applications d’exploration de données.

L’utilisation de la TCAM a permis des opérations de réseau plus rapides et plus précises ainsi qu’une meilleure sécurité du réseau. Elle a également permis des opérations d’exploration de données plus efficaces et le développement d’applications réseau plus sophistiquées.

L’avenir de la TCAM

La demande d’opérations réseau plus rapides et plus efficaces ne cesse d’augmenter, tout comme le besoin de technologies de mémoire haute performance telles que la TCAM. Au fur et à mesure que la technologie TCAM progresse, elle deviendra de plus en plus importante pour garantir des opérations réseau à haut débit.

FAQ
La TCAM est-elle une RAM ?

La TCAM n’est pas une RAM, mais c’est un type de mémoire qui sert à stocker des données pour un accès rapide. La TCAM est utilisée pour stocker des informations d’une manière facile à rechercher et à récupérer, ce qui la rend idéale pour les routeurs et autres dispositifs qui doivent accéder rapidement aux données.

Quelle est la différence entre CAM et TCAM ?

La CAM (Content Addressable Memory) est un type de mémoire qui stocke les données de manière à pouvoir les récupérer très rapidement. La mémoire CAM est souvent utilisée pour stocker des données fréquemment consultées, comme la mémoire cache d’un ordinateur. La mémoire TCAM (Ternary Content Addressable Memory) est un type de mémoire CAM qui peut stocker trois valeurs (0, 1 ou X) dans chaque cellule de mémoire. La TCAM est souvent utilisée pour stocker des données qui peuvent être exprimées sous forme de fonction booléenne, comme une table de routage.

Qu’est-ce qu’une règle TCAM ?

Une règle TCAM est un dispositif de mémoire informatique qui stocke les données utilisées pour la consultation des tables dans un routeur ou un commutateur de réseau. Les données sont organisées en règles, chacune d’entre elles étant constituée d’un ensemble de valeurs qui définissent une condition de correspondance. Lorsqu’un paquet arrive sur le routeur ou le commutateur, les valeurs du paquet sont comparées aux valeurs des règles TCAM. Si une correspondance est trouvée, le routeur ou le commutateur prend l’action spécifiée par la règle.

Qu’est-ce qui est stocké dans la TCAM ?

La TCAM (Transmission Control and Address Matching) est une mémoire à haut débit utilisée dans les routeurs et les commutateurs pour stocker les informations de routage. Ces informations comprennent l’adresse de destination, l’adresse du prochain saut et la métrique de routage. La TCAM est utilisée pour consulter rapidement ces informations et prendre des décisions de transfert.

Qu’est-ce que la TCAM dans le SDN ?

La TCAM est un type spécial de mémoire haute vitesse utilisé dans les routeurs et les commutateurs pour stocker les informations de routage et de filtrage. La TCAM est utilisée pour stocker des informations telles que l’adresse de destination d’un paquet, l’adresse source d’un paquet, le type de paquet et le port vers lequel le paquet doit être transféré. La TCAM est utilisée par les routeurs et les commutateurs pour prendre des décisions de transfert.